Japanese Skewer (Yakitori/Kushiyaki) Recipe

Delicious and easy-to-make Japanese skewers perfect for any occasion.
Print Recipe
Preparation Time: 20 minutes
Cook Time: 15 minutes
Total Time: 35 minutes
Course: Main Course
Cuisine: Japanese
Servings: 4 servings
Calories: 250 kcal

Ingredients 

Main Ingredients

  • 500 g Chicken Thighs cut into bite-sized pieces
  • 1 bunch Green Onions cut into 1-inch pieces
  • ½ cup Soy Sauce
  • ¼ cup Mirin
  • ¼ cup Sake
  • 2 tablespoon Sugar

Instructions 

  1. 1. Soak the skewers in water for at least 30 minutes.
  2. 2. Thread the chicken and green onions onto the skewers, alternating between the two.
  3. 3. In a small saucepan, combine soy sauce, mirin, sake, and sugar.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er for 5 minutes. Set aside to cool.
  4. 4. Preheat the grill to medium-high heat.
  5. 5. Grill the skewers for about 10-15 minutes, turning occasionally and basting with the sauce until the chicken is cooked through and slightly charred.
